Giving Back Through Service: Community Development Guide

community event

Volunteering time and effort to improve your community can be mutually beneficial for you and those around you. While you may be looking to give back or get involved in something outside of your day-to-day routine, working on community development projects can also provide a sense of pride and ownership in where you live.

If you’re considering taking on a community development project, there are a few ideas that you might consider pursuing.

Building A Community Garden

Does your neighborhood have a public space that you could turn into something more appealing? Perhaps a community garden is something that you could spearhead. This type of project can provide fresh fruits and vegetables for residents and a sense of community involvement and beautification of the area.

It might be the perfect project if you have some green thumbs in your area. Plus, you can always use the produce from the garden to host a community potluck or picnic in the park.

However, it’s best to ask your local government before starting this project. They may have regulations in place or could connect you with resources to help get the project off the ground.

Starting a Local Sports Center

If you’re looking for a project that will require more of a time commitment, starting a local sports center could be the perfect solution. This type of community development project can take many forms, such as creating an after-school facility at a nearby school or building a public sports park within the city.

This project will provide opportunities for children and adults to stay active and help build a sense of community. This way, you can encourage every community member, no matter their age, to live a healthier and happier life.

You’ll need to do some research and speak with local officials to see if there’s already an ongoing project. If not, you’ll need to figure out how to get the funding and support to make it happen. It will be a lot of work, but it will be worth it.

Operating A Mobile Health Clinic

Another excellent community development project is starting a mobile health clinic. It can be a great way to provide access to medical care for those who live in rural areas or who don’t have insurance.

You’ll need to partner with a local hospital or health center to get started. They can provide the supplies and personnel necessary to make the clinic a success. You’ll also need to find a place to set up the clinic, such as a church or community center.

When setting up your mobile clinic, you need to maintain privacy and safety for everyone involved. A foldable curtain can provide the privacy patients need, while a trailer-mounted compact air compressor helps keep air quality high inside the mobile clinic. You should also have a first-aid kit on hand in case of accidents or emergencies. In doing so, you’ll be able to provide quality care for your community.

Establishing A Neighborhood Kitchen

Are there any food deserts in your area? If so, you could help by establishing a neighborhood kitchen. This facility can provide healthy meals for those who might not otherwise have access to them.

You’ll need to find a space to set up the kitchen and work with local grocery stores or farms to get the food. You’ll also need to find volunteers to help cook and serve the meals.

This project can be a great way to improve the health of your community and fight hunger. It’s also an opportunity to get people involved in their community and build relationships with those who live around them. So, if you’re looking for a way to give back, this could be the perfect solution.

Creating A Community Space

Community events are essential for building a sense of togetherness. But without a dedicated space, they can be challenging to organize. That’s why creating community space is such an important project.

This space can be helpful for a variety of events, such as concerts, festivals, and farmers’ markets. It can also be a place for people to gather and socialize. You can transform stadiums, parks, and even vacant lots into community spaces.

It’s crucial to involve the community in the planning process. This way, you can ensure that the space meets their needs. You should also consult with local officials to get permits and approvals. With some hard work, you can create a space that will bring people together and improve your community.
